Abstract
A two aerosol can injection system has a first aerosol can containing product and propellant; a second aerosol can containing activator or hardener; and a connector connected at a first end to the first aerosol can and at a second end to the second aerosol can. The connector has a first internal thread valve connected to the first aerosol can, and a second internal thread valve connected to the second aerosol can.
